Hidden Figures

During America's Space Race against the Russians, everyone knew the names of Alan Shepard, Gus Grissom, & John Glenn but this story is about 3 unsung heroes. They were 3 black women working at NASA at the time; a want-to-be supervisor (Olivia Spenser), an aspiring engineer (Janelle Monae), & a math whiz (Taraji P. Henson). Based on true events, this entertaining & enlightening film reveals how these proud, intelligent, & determined women persevered with dignity under an era of unjust prejudice & segregation. Kevin Costner, Jim Parsons, & Kirsten Dunst are among the wonderful supporting cast. Even though this inspirational film contrives situations to dramatically & humorously make its points, it's still a highly enjoyable feel good movie. This is one of the greatest stories never told & a behind the scenes look at the US space program. Look for photos & summaries about the real people portrayed at the end of the film.

Alien gives it 3½ "Mercury-Atlas 6,  Friendship 7" stars out of 4.
